How To Fix TRF0102 - No short position is selected


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: TRF0 - TRF Messages

  • Message number: 102

  • Message text: No short position is selected

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message TRF0102 - No short position is selected ?

    The SAP error message TRF0102, which states "No short position is selected," typically occurs in the context of Treasury and Risk Management (TRM) within SAP. This error is related to the management of financial instruments, particularly when dealing with positions in securities or derivatives.

    Cause:

    The error message TRF0102 usually arises due to one of the following reasons:

    1. No Short Position Exists: The system is trying to process a transaction that requires a short position, but there are no short positions available in the system for the specified security or financial instrument.

    2. Incorrect Selection: The user may not have selected the appropriate short position when attempting to execute a transaction, such as a closing transaction or a hedge.

    3. Data Inconsistency: There may be inconsistencies in the data related to the positions, such as missing or incorrect entries in the position management tables.

    4. Authorization Issues: The user may not have the necessary authorizations to view or select short positions.

    Solution:

    To resolve the TRF0102 error, you can take the following steps:

    1. Check for Existing Short Positions:

      • Navigate to the relevant transaction or report in SAP that displays the positions.
      • Verify if there are any short positions available for the financial instrument you are working with.
    2. Select the Correct Position:

      • Ensure that you are selecting the correct short position in the transaction. If you are unsure, consult with your finance or treasury team for guidance.
    3. Review Data Entries:

      • Check the data entries related to the positions in the system. Ensure that all necessary data is correctly entered and that there are no missing records.
    4. Authorization Check:

      • Confirm that you have the necessary authorizations to access and select short positions. If not, contact your system administrator or security team to request the appropriate access.
    5. Consult Documentation:

      • Refer to SAP documentation or help resources for specific guidance on handling positions in the Treasury module.
    6. Contact Support:

      • If the issue persists after checking the above points, consider reaching out to your SAP support team or consulting with SAP support for further assistance.

    Related Information:

    • SAP Modules: This error is primarily related to the Treasury and Risk Management (TRM) module in SAP.
    • Transaction Codes: Familiarize yourself with relevant transaction codes such as TPM1, TPM2, or TPM3 for managing positions and transactions in TRM.
